Skip to content

Instantly share code, notes, and snippets.

@craigbruenderman
Last active June 10, 2022 18:23
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save craigbruenderman/a83b70c9041651bf9338aa62c99d914e to your computer and use it in GitHub Desktop.
Save craigbruenderman/a83b70c9041651bf9338aa62c99d914e to your computer and use it in GitHub Desktop.
#!/bin/bash
HOST=cpmasesx01.na.domain.com
PASSWD=
for m in $(cat list.txt)
do
MACHINE_PATH=`sshpass -p $PASSWD ssh root@$HOST find /vmfs/volumes/ -name $m -print`
if [ -z "$MACHINE_PATH" ]
then
echo "$m not on host"
else
echo "Cloning $MACHINE_PATH"
sshpass -p $PASSWD scp -r root@$HOST:$MACHINE_PATH/ /Volumes/Untitled
fi
done
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ment